SPEAKING OF DANCE

“In the United States, at least, dance theater often amounts to mawkish dancing to the choreographer’s own low-grade romantic poetry, clichéd movement interpretations of blundering political rants, or performance art studded with feeble moments of affectless gesture. In each case, the perpetrator pumps up one medium at the expense of the other. But in witty Aerobia, an agile and nuanced relationship develops between the talking and the dancing.” The New York Times 11/11/01 (one-time registration required for access)
